Undergraduate i-PREP (international - Preparation and Regulatory Education Program)
i-PREP is a program designed for incoming international undergraduate students that prepares them for their studies and teaches them about the immigration regulations they must adhere to. This orientation is mandatory for all new Rice international undergraduate students. Other orientation activities for all incoming Rice undergraduates are held in the week following i-PREP.

The following requirements must be met for the freshman admission application:

  • Part I and II of the Rice Application
  • a $50 nonrefundable application fee
  • your official high school transcript
  • SAT, or ACT with the writing test
  • two SAT Subject tests (in subjects related to proposed area of study)
  • recommendations from your high school counselor and at least one academic teacher
  • a portfolio for applicants to the School of Architecture
  • an audition for applicants to the Shepherd School of Music
  • a personal interview is OPTIONAL, but recommended
